Shinsuke Nakamura’s story can be compared with that of another wrestler mentioned earlier, AJ Styles. This is yet another prolific talent we are very fortunate to watch on a weekly basis.
With Nakamura, there is certainly a slight issue with the language barrier but it is something that he has been working very hard at, and he seems to be improving on a consistent basis. The fact is, Shinsuke will continue to improve, but if his biggest flaw is a minor language discrepancy, I’ll take it all day long.
